The Mechanical CAD Designer will provide design and draft support, ensuring high-quality 3D modeling and 2D drawings while collaborating with engineers to meet project demands.
Responsibilities
- Create the foundation of a design from a ‘blank sheet’ to create the initial design concept and layout
- Assist Sales and Proposals with the initial design prior to tender
- Work with Mechanical & Electrical Engineers to develop generic design concepts and interface with CAD design tools to verify correct design detail
- Produce 3D modelled parts using AutoCAD of all entities necessary to fully populate the design in 3D
- Develop the general arrangements included in a tender into a full suite of design deliverables including but not limited to process & instrumentation diagrams, general layouts of the proposed installation (plan, elevation and isometric), detailed fabrication drawings of pipe supports and equipment skids etc, equipment lists for engineers to populate
- Liaise with relevant Clarke Energy personnel, within the engineering and other functions, on all aspects of the Projects developing design. Sub-contractors to resolve design and/or implementation issues as they arise. Site Engineers during the installation phase of the project to support and resolve issues as necessary
- Attend site to undertake site surveys to fully capture all project related data. ‘As-Built’ installation survey necessary to amend construction issued deliverables
- Maintain Autocad functionality, fault finding and setting up of computer systems drafting function
- Develop and maintain library of generic design of components to reduce repetition and design time
- Assist and guide less experienced and Apprentice Designers, providing training and support as necessary
- Assist in maintaining training and development for the Design section
- Assist in meeting section key performance indicators as required by the business
- Ensure that there is full adherence to Health, Safety, Environmental and Quality management policies, CDM and procedures in all work undertaken
